Gerontius is a Latin name derived from the Greek 'geron', meaning 'old'. It carries connotations of wisdom, experience, and respect, often associated with elder statesmen or revered figures. The name has historical and literary significance, appearing in early Christian contexts and classical literature. Its rarity adds a sense of uniqueness and gravitas.
